Madison township is located in Jefferson County, Indiana. Madison township has a 2025 population of 1,263. Madison township is currently declining at a rate of -0.39% annually and its population has decreased by -1.56%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 1,283 in 2020.
The average household income in Madison township is $94,025 with a poverty rate of 23.94%.The median age in Madison township is 40.2 years: 45.1 years for males, and 38.8 years for females.

Madison township's average per capita income is $56,138. Household income levels show a median of $74,219. The poverty rate stands at 23.94%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$115,599 | - |
Families | $89,750 | $104,504 |
Households | $74,219 | $94,025 |
Non Families | $50,948 | $54,516 |
